
Yugoslavia
Yugoslavia was a socialist state in Southeast Europe that existed from 1945 until its dissolution in the early 1990s. It gained notoriety during the Kosovo War, particularly for the downing of an American F-117 stealth fighter in 1999, a significant event that raised questions about the effectiveness of stealth technology and had lasting implications on military strategies.
